Tesla's Q3 2025 Earnings Outlook: A Record Quarter with Future Challenges

Tesla is poised to unveil its third-quarter financial outcomes for 2025, with industry observers keenly watching for insights into the company's performance. The electric vehicle giant is expected to report a period of unprecedented revenue growth, largely propelled by a significant surge in both vehicle deliveries and the rollout of energy storage solutions. However, this promising top-line performance is tempered by analyst projections of a continued decline in earnings per share, attributed to strategic price adjustments made by the company. Upcoming discussions are anticipated to cover Tesla's ambitious initiatives, including the progression of its Robotaxi services, the development of new vehicle models, and updates on the Optimus robot project. A critical factor influencing future quarters will be the phasing out of tax incentives, which could introduce a period of market adjustment following this potentially banner quarter.

Tesla is scheduled to release its Q3 2025 financial figures on Wednesday, October 22, following the close of market trading. The announcement will be succeeded by the customary conference call and a question-and-answer session featuring Tesla's leadership team. This event will provide a detailed overview of the company's financial health and strategic direction, offering clarity on the factors driving its record-setting revenue while addressing concerns about profit margins.

While CEO Elon Musk frequently characterizes Tesla as a pioneer in artificial intelligence and robotics, the core of the company's financial success continues to reside within its automotive sector. Vehicle sales remain the primary engine of Tesla's revenue generation. Earlier in the month, the company revealed impressive Q3 2025 production and delivery statistics, showcasing a record number of vehicles successfully delivered to customers. Specifically, Model 3/Y production reached 435,826 units, with 481,166 deliveries, while other models accounted for 11,624 in production and 15,933 deliveries, culminating in a grand total of 447,450 vehicles produced and 497,099 delivered. Complementing this, Tesla also deployed a substantial 12.5 GWh of energy storage capacity during the quarter. These combined achievements are expected to translate into significantly higher reported revenues.

For the third quarter's revenue, market analysts have largely formed a consensus, informed by the publicly released delivery and energy deployment figures. The prevailing Wall Street estimate stands at $26.457 billion, although Estimize, a platform that aggregates financial forecasts from various sources, predicts a slightly lower figure of $26.266 billion. Should Tesla achieve or surpass these expectations, it would signify its most lucrative quarter to date in terms of revenue. However, despite the projected record revenue, analysts do not foresee a corresponding peak in earnings. This discrepancy is attributed to the company's recent decision to lower vehicle prices in response to an intensifying competitive landscape. The Wall Street consensus for Q3 2025 earnings per share is $0.55, with Estimize offering a marginally higher estimate of $0.57. This suggests a continuation of a downward trend in earnings, particularly when compared to the $0.72 per share reported during the same period last year.

Looking ahead to the shareholder's letter and the analyst call, a notably optimistic tone from management is anticipated for Q3. This sentiment is partly influenced by the strategic timing of the shareholders' meeting, which was postponed to early November. The company likely recognized that the impending expiration of tax credits would accelerate demand into Q3, thereby bolstering quarterly results. Despite the expectation of more challenging quarters in the future, Tesla plans to highlight this strong performance ahead of critical shareholder votes concerning Musk's compensation and board appointments. However, Wall Street analysts are expected to probe into Tesla's projected performance for the upcoming quarters, particularly in light of the changing landscape of US incentives and credits. The company will also field questions from retail investors, with popular inquiries focusing on Robotaxi metrics, energy storage demand, plans for new vehicle models, and the progress of the Optimus robot project. Many of these questions reflect a keen interest in Tesla's future products and Elon Musk's often bold predictions regarding their market impact, even as the company's core automotive business faces declining earnings.

Tesla Recalls Model 3 and Model Y Vehicles Due to Battery Pack Fault

Tesla has initiated a recall for approximately 13,000 recently produced Model 3 and Model Y vehicles. This action stems from a detected flaw within the battery pack system, specifically an issue with certain contactors, which could lead to an unexpected loss of power while the vehicle is in operation. Such a malfunction presents a significant safety concern, as it directly increases the potential for accidents. The company has identified that vehicles manufactured between March and August 2025 are primarily affected, underscoring the urgency of this corrective measure to ensure driver and passenger safety.

The issue first surfaced in August, when Tesla began receiving reports from owners of newly purchased Model 3 and Model Y vehicles experiencing sudden power losses. Following a thorough investigation that included reviewing 36 warranty claims and 26 field reports, the automaker pinpointed the cause. The defect lies in specific battery pack contactors, components critical for regulating power flow within the battery system. This fault impacts an estimated 8,000 Model Y and 5,000 Model 3 units assembled in the United States during the aforementioned period.

The official recall notification from Tesla specifies that the affected population includes certain Model Year 2025 Model 3 vehicles produced between March 8, 2025, and August 12, 2025, and Model Year 2026 Model Y vehicles manufactured between March 15, 2025, and August 15, 2025. These vehicles are equipped with battery pack contactors that utilize an InTiCa solenoid, which has been identified as the root cause of the problem. If these contactors unexpectedly disengage while the vehicle is in motion, it can result in a complete loss of drive power and the ability to apply torque, thereby significantly elevating the risk of a collision.

Tesla's investigation further revealed that two suppliers, Sistemas Mecatrónicos InTiCa S.A.P.I., a tier-2 supplier based in Mexico, and SongChuan, a tier-1 supplier located in Taiwan, were involved in the provision of the faulty components. In response, Tesla has confirmed that it is actively contacting all vehicle owners potentially impacted by this defect. The company has pledged to replace the compromised contactors with certified components that do not incorporate the problematic InTica solenoid and maintain a secure coil termination connection. This repair will be performed at no cost to the vehicle owners, reinforcing Tesla's commitment to addressing safety issues promptly and efficiently.

US Wind Power Poised for Significant Rebound with 7.7 GW Forecasted Growth

Following a subdued initial period, the United States' wind energy sector is on track for a strong resurgence, anticipating a total of 7.7 gigawatts in new capacity installations this year. A report from Wood Mackenzie and the American Clean Power Association (ACP) indicated a 60% decline in new wind capacity during the second quarter of 2025 compared to the previous year, with only 593 megawatts installed. However, the industry is projected to experience a significant rebound, with over half of the year's forecasted capacity expected to come online in the final quarter.

The onshore wind development faces both opportunities and challenges. The market outlook for onshore wind saw a 3.6% increase quarter-over-quarter as developers accelerate project completion to capitalize on expiring federal tax credits. Experts note that many projects are construction-ready with necessary permits and turbine orders in place. Nevertheless, the industry faces long-term uncertainties due to ongoing tariff investigations, which could impact a significant portion of the wind turbine supply chain and increase project costs, potentially delaying developments beyond 2027. Additionally, the offshore wind sector, despite regulatory hurdles and stop-work orders, is expected to add 5.9 GW by 2029, with most of this capacity already under construction and slated for completion in 2026 and 2027. Western states are poised to lead onshore wind activity through 2029, followed by the Midwest, with Illinois projected to surpass Texas in new onshore capacity by 2027.

Looking ahead, the next few years are critical for the US wind industry, with 2027 anticipated to be a landmark year for new installations. Wood Mackenzie forecasts an average annual installation of 9.1 GW over the next five years, encompassing onshore, offshore, and repowering projects. By the close of 2029, the total installed wind capacity is projected to reach 196.5 GW. This substantial growth is expected despite political headwinds and anti-wind rhetoric, demonstrating the sector's resilience and its continued significant presence in the energy market, even as solar and energy storage lead overall interconnection activity.
